A PAIR OF EDWARDIAN SILVER FISH-SERVERS IN THE 18TH CENTURY MANNER,
MARK OF PETER HENDERSON DEERE, LONDON, 1901,
The dolphin stems terminating in spirally fluted wood handles, the blade of fish serving knife pierced with foliate scrollwork around a vacant oval reserve. (2)
